Connection between the family crest and the lineage of Dragovi

The link between the heraldic blazon and Dragovi is a relationship that goes beyond what can apparently be perceived. In the beginning, coats of arms were awarded to specific individuals and not to an entire family; they were symbols of merit, bravery or social status of the person who wore them. Over time, the shield of Dragovi would become an emblem that would be transmitted from generation to generation, thus representing the lineage and ancestry of the surname Dragovi.

Points of interest about the connection between the family coat of arms and the name Dragovi

Generational transmission: Although the coat of arms may be associated with Dragovi, it is essential to note that they were traditionally granted to individuals. This implies that not all people with the surname Dragovi automatically have heraldic rights to the shield linked to Dragovi, especially if they cannot prove direct ancestry with the original bearer of the blazon. Likewise, it is possible to find different shields corresponding to the surname Dragovi, since these could have been granted to people of different lineages but with the surname Dragovi.

Variations: Within a family that shares the surname Dragovi, it is common to find different versions of the heraldic shield. These variations may arise to distinguish between different family branches, generations, or even to represent individual titles granted throughout family history.

Heritage and administration: In various nations, there are competent bodies in heraldic matters that are responsible for supervising the procedure, management, and control of coats of arms in order to guarantee their proper use and transmission for the Dragovi family. These entities can provide assistance in research and certification tasks for those who wish to formally adopt the heraldic emblem linked to Dragovi.
